

On May 19th, we lost our sweet, beautiful, and beloved Finn. After a courageous 15-month battle with rhabdomyosarcoma, a rare and aggressive childhood cancer, Finn passed away peacefully at home, surrounded by his loving family.
Despite the immense challenges he faced and difficult treatment he underwent, Finn remained
positive, kind, and selfless. His strength and compassion touched everyone who knew him.
He was more concerned for those who loved him than for himself, even in the face of
overwhelming pain. Finley formed deep bonds with the nurses, therapists, and staff at Children’s Medical Center Dallas, who cared for him with unwavering dedication and in whose hearts he will always remain.
Finn was the cherished middle son of Jason and Kirsten Maxwell of Colleyville, TX, and beloved
brother to Gavin and Ronan. He was the grandson of Jeff and Debbie Schweizer of Chandler, AZ,
Betty Maxwell of Dallas, and the late Alfred Maxwell. He was also the nephew of Kori and
Michael Agic of Mt. Dora, FL, Dirk and Gretchen Maxwell of Nashville, TN, and the late Stacy
Maxwell. He was a loving cousin to Kiera and Landon Agic, and Marshall and Meredith Maxwell.
Finn grew up in Lake Forest, Illinois, before moving to Texas in 2019. He graduated from
Colleyville Heritage High School in 2023. At the time of his diagnosis, he was an honors student
at the University of Arkansas.
We miss Finn beyond words, but we find comfort in knowing he is now free from pain and at peace in Heaven.
